Project Manager (Construction)

House Buyers of America is looking for a Field Manager who will be responsible for the project management of our home renovations. This person will oversee all aspects of 5-10 projects per month including bidding out jobs, permitting work and ensuring everything is completed according to the project timeline. This person will drive to and work from different job sites scattered throughout the greater DMV Area area therefore you must live in Maryland, DC or Virginia. We do not have a corporate office to report into. This is a field based role.

What you will do:
  • Manage and complete 5-10 projects per month according to the set project timeline
  • Recruit contractors and manage contracts for all trades and subcontractors
  • Strive to complete projects below budget and seek ways to reduce costs and streamline the construction process
  • Manage project timeline, respond to all inspections
  • Deliver equipment to job sites if needed
  • Conduct final inspections of homes to ensure all work was completed properly and take detailed photos of the property

About You:
  • You have 5+ years of real estate project management experience in home building, home renovations or insurance restoration
  • You have excellent computer skills (including Microsoft Office)
  • You have a Bachelor's Degree or higher

Total Compensation Range: $80,000- $130,000/ year inclusive of base and bonus
